文件名称:matlab集成c代码-Lauderdale_etal_2016_GBC:诊断程序,用于量化海洋生物地球化学模型中海气中CO2通量的驱动因素
文件大小:273.55MB
文件格式:ZIP
更新时间:2024-06-10 20:58:10
系统开源
Matlab集成的c代码Lauderdale_etal_2016_GBC的CO2通量诊断程序 根据全球生物地球化学循环中的乔纳森·劳德代尔(Jonathan Lauderdale),斯蒂芬妮·杜特凯维兹(Stephanie Dutkiewicz),里克·威廉姆斯(Ric Williams)和米克(Mick)的论文“量化海洋-大气中二氧化碳的通量驱动因素”,从稳态模型计算二氧化碳通量诊断。 如果您发现研究中使用了这些工具,请引用本文(徽章中的链接)。 该框架评估以下各项之间的相互作用: 影响潜在饱和碳浓度的表面热和淡水通量取决于海面温度,盐度和碱度的变化, 残余的不平衡通量受到海洋内部再矿化的富含碳和营养的富矿水的上升和夹带以及地表水的快速俯冲的影响, 碳的吸收和通过生物活性作为软组织和碳酸盐输出,以及 由于淡水沉淀或蒸发而对表面碳浓度的影响。 在粗分辨率海洋环流和生物地球化学模型的稳态模拟中,各个确定成分的总和接近模拟的已知总通量。 如有任何疑问或意见,请联系! 新:PYTHON代码(适用于v3.7) 请参阅Jupyter笔记本中的演示CO2_Flux_Drivers_Online.i
【文件预览】:
Lauderdale_etal_2016_GBC-master
----Longhurst_world_v4_2010.shx(532B)
----Longhurst_world_v4_2010.shp(2.83MB)
----change.m(2KB)
----isvar.m(3KB)
----model_kpp()
--------pickup_dic_co2atm.0018000000.data(16B)
--------ptr_do2.bin(480KB)
--------state.0018000000.glob.nc(30.88MB)
--------do2_flxDiag.0018000000.glob.nc(133B)
--------data.gmredi(740B)
--------tren_taux.bin(384KB)
--------data.ptracers(2KB)
--------dic_atmos.0018000000.txt(988B)
--------dop_flxDiag.0018000000.glob.nc(73.13MB)
--------po4_flxDiag.0018000000.glob.nc(73.13MB)
--------data.gchem(49B)
--------pickup_cd.0018000000.meta(231B)
--------flxDiag.0018000000.glob.nc(78.76MB)
--------data(3KB)
--------ptr_dop.bin(480KB)
--------data.mnc(378B)
--------ptr_fe.bin(480KB)
--------depth_g77.bin(32KB)
--------dic_tave.0018000000.glob.nc(16.88MB)
--------alk_flxDiag.0018000000.glob.nc(73.13MB)
--------dicDiag.0018000000.glob.nc(39.38MB)
--------grid.glob.nc(6.01MB)
--------fice.bin(384KB)
--------ptr_alk.bin(480KB)
--------gmDiag.0018000000.glob.nc(78.76MB)
--------data.diagnostics(5KB)
--------pickup.0018000000.meta(430B)
--------data.dic(2KB)
--------pickup_dic_co2atm.0018000000.meta(251B)
--------lev_clim_temp.bin(480KB)
--------pickup_dic.0018000000.meta(320B)
--------pickup_dic.0018000000.data(64KB)
--------lev_clim_salt.bin(480KB)
--------kppDiag.0018000000.glob.nc(67.5MB)
--------shi_empmr_year.bin(384KB)
--------pickup_cd.0018000000.data(3.81MB)
--------dic_surfDiag.0018000000.glob.nc(1.88MB)
--------data.pkg(142B)
--------surfDiag.0018000000.glob.nc(1.13MB)
--------ptr_tave.0018000000.glob.nc(33.75MB)
--------mah_somtimind_molfem2s.bin(384KB)
--------pickup_ptracers.0018000000.meta(395B)
--------tren_speed.bin(384KB)
--------lev_monthly_salt.bin(384KB)
--------pickup.0018000000.data(7.69MB)
--------pickup_ptracers.0018000000.data(5.63MB)
--------oceDiag.0018000000.glob.nc(45.01MB)
--------data.kpp(87B)
--------ptr_po4.bin(480KB)
--------dic_flxDiag.0018000000.glob.nc(73.13MB)
--------ptracers.0018000000.glob.nc(36.57MB)
--------shi_qnet.bin(384KB)
--------sillev1.bin(480KB)
--------fe_flxDiag.0018000000.glob.nc(133B)
--------tren_tauy.bin(384KB)
--------lev_monthly_temp.bin(384KB)
--------ptr_dic.bin(480KB)
--------tave.0018000000.glob.nc(28.13MB)
----mit_getparm.m(3KB)
----Longhurst_world_v4_2010.dbf(6KB)
----Longhurst_world_v4_2010.shp.xml(8KB)
----calc_ddicdvar.m(12KB)
----python-fortran-interface()
--------offline_consts.h(465B)
--------offline_routines_python.F(97KB)
--------offline_zonal_advection.h(647B)
--------offline_merid_advection.h(647B)
--------offline_divergence.h(572B)
--------offline_vert_advection.h(583B)
----LICENSE(1KB)
----mit_gmvel.m(5KB)
----figure4_masks.mat(117KB)
----CO2_Flux_Drivers_Online.ipynb(2.68MB)
----matlab-fortran-interface()
--------implicit_diffusion_flux.F(19KB)
--------vertically_integrate.F(12KB)
--------diffusion_flux.F(33KB)
--------advection_flux.F(92KB)
--------calc_smooth_divergence.F(25KB)
--------calc_divergence.F(17KB)
----mit_oceanmasks.m(16KB)
----woa13_basinmask_01.msk(8.83MB)
----get_kave.m(988B)
----README.md(5KB)
----Longhurst_world_v4_2010.sbx(164B)
----cflux_diags.m(39KB)
----Longhurst_world_v4_2010.sbn(652B)
----mit_loadgrid.m(6KB)
----co2_flux_steadystate.m(99KB)
----woa13_annual_silicate.nc(134B)
----.gitattributes(41B)
----Longhurst_world_v4_2010.prj(145B)